商城数据表设计图简述 (一般商城数据库表设计图)

随着电子商务的兴起,各类商城网站成为商家展示商品和服务、吸引消费者的重要平台。在这个过程中,数据表的设计和优化显得尤为重要。本文将会对商城数据表设计图进行简述。

一、商城数据表设计的基本原则

为了确保商城数据表设计的合理性和可扩展性,应当遵循以下基本原则:

1.尽量避免重复数据

2.合理设置表之间的关联关系

3.按照数据操作频率排列表中字段

4.正确选择数据类型

5.合理设置索引以提高查询效率

二、商城数据表设计图的主要内容

商城数据表设计图按照功能划分,大致可以分为以下几个方面:

1.用户管理

商城的用户管理包括用户注册、登录、个人信息管理等。在数据表设计中,需要包括用户信息表、用户登录日志表、用户充值记录表、地址管理表等多个表,来保证用户信息和操作的安全性和完整性。

2.商品管理

商品的管理是商城网站的核心,其包括商品信息管理、库存管理、分类管理、品牌管理等。在数据表设计中,商品信息表、商品浏览量表、商品分类表、商品品牌表等是非常重要的表,需要结构合理、字段齐全。

3.订单管理

订单管理是商城网站的重点,其包括下单、支付、收货、售后等多个环节。在数据表设计中,需要包括订单信息表、订单商品表、收货地址表、订单支付日志表、订单退货日志表等多个表,以保证订单数据的完整性和安全性。

4.支付管理

支付管理是商城网站需要考虑的一个重要方面,它涉及到对用户支付信息的记录和处理。在数据表设计中,需要包括支付方式表、交易记录表、退款记录表等,以确保支付信息的流畅和安全。

5.营销管理

营销管理是商城网站的另一个重点方面,它涉及到用户优惠券、促销活动、卡券管理等。在数据表设计中,需要包括优惠券表、促销活动表、礼品卡表、抢购记录表等多个表格,以保证营销数据的完整性和安全性。

三、商城数据表设计错误常见表现

商城数据表设计错误常见表现如下:

1.冗余字段过多

2.表的结构不合理

3.关联关系设置不当

4.不合理的数据类型

5.索引设置不当

四、商城数据表设计的优化

为了进一步提升商城数据表的效率和性能,需要进行优化,具体操作如下:

1.删除冗余字段

2.合并数据表结构

3.设置适当的索引

4.数据库分区

5.使用缓存技术

综上所述,商城数据表设计是商城网站架构非常重要的一部分,它影响着数据操作效率、用户体验、网站稳定性等方面。在设计和优化过程中,需要综合考虑数据流程、用户需求、系统架构等多个方面,做到合理结构、高效执行、安全稳定。

相关问题拓展阅读:

多用户商城数据库如何设计

差不多都是一个 文章表,用户表,分类表,设置表。

1、数据库分离成前台和后台,通过链接表关联;

2、把前台做成弹出窗体,禁止用户使用导航选项和菜单之类;

3、把前台编译成ACCESS2023的accde文件(对应ACCESS2023的mde文件);

4、把这个accde文件也放在服务器端,客户端通过winform之类exe来远程打开。

前3步都比较正常,第4步的看起来应该比较奇怪。我的想法是,如果accde文件也放在客户端,高手会不会通过反编译就可以进入到数据库看到链接表?感觉上“禁止Shift”,“隐藏表”这类手段只对菜鸟有用。

一般商城数据库表设计图的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于一般商城数据库表设计图,商城数据表设计图简述,多用户商城数据库如何设计的信息别忘了在本站进行查找喔。


数据运维技术 » 商城数据表设计图简述 (一般商城数据库表设计图)